Skip to content

AleFalces/Front-animals-deploy

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

21 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

🐶 Buddy Ong – Frontend

Buddy Ong es una aplicación web de rescate y adopción de animales, desarrollada en equipo como proyecto final del bootcamp Henry. El objetivo principal fue construir un MVP completo que integrara una pasarela de pagos para donaciones, filtros avanzados y un panel administrativo completo, aplicando buenas prácticas de planificación, trabajo grupal y desarrollo end-to-end.

Este repositorio contiene el frontend de la aplicación, desarrollado con React.js, Redux y Chakra UI.

🚀 Deploy online

🔗 https://buddyong.vercel.app/

🛠️ Tecnologías utilizadas

  • React.js
  • Redux
  • Chakra UI
  • JavaScript
  • React Router
  • Axios
  • Google Maps API (geolocalización)
  • Stripe (pasarela de pagos)
  • Cookies y caché para manejo de sesión
  • Responsive Design
  • Git & GitFlow
  • Metodología SCRUM

🔐 Funcionalidades principales

  • Registro e inicio de sesión con autenticación por JWT
  • Roles de usuario: administrador y usuario común
  • Publicación y visualización de mascotas disponibles para adopción
  • Panel administrativo completo para gestionar usuarios y publicaciones
  • Filtros avanzados por ubicación, tamaño y edad
  • Geolocalización de veterinarias cercanas mediante Google Maps
  • Donaciones con integración a Stripe
  • Manejo del estado global con Redux
  • Cookies para persistencia de sesión
  • Diseño totalmente responsive y accesible

📦 Instalación local

  1. Cloná este repositorio: git clone https://github.com/AleFalces/Front-animals-deploy

  2. Instalá las dependencias: npm install

  3. Ejecutá el servidor de desarrollo: npm start

  4. Sigue las instrucciones del Back-end para ver el funcionamiento del proyecto completo: Link: https://github.com/AleFalces/backAnimals

About

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published